

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

# Avaliações para todos os tipos de endpoints
<a name="CHAP_Tasks.AssessmentReport.Assessments.All"></a>

Esta seção descreve avaliações de pré-migração individuais para todos os tipos de endpoints.

**Topics**
+ [Tipos de dados incompatíveis](#CHAP_Tasks.AssessmentReport.Assessments.All.UnsupportedDataTypes)
+ [Objetos grandes (LOBs) são usados, mas as colunas LOB de destino não são anuláveis](#CHAP_Tasks.AssessmentReport.Assessments.All.LOBsColsNotNullable)
+ [Tabela de origem com objetos grandes (LOBs), mas sem chaves primárias ou restrições exclusivas](#CHAP_Tasks.AssessmentReport.Assessments.All.LOBsNoPrimaryKey)
+ [Tabela de origem sem chave primária somente para tarefas de CDC ou de carga máxima e CDC](#CHAP_Tasks.AssessmentReport.Assessments.All.CDCNoPrimaryKey)
+ [Tabela de destino sem chaves primárias somente para tarefas de CDC](#CHAP_Tasks.AssessmentReport.Assessments.All.CDCOnlyNoPrimaryKey)
+ [Tipos de chave primária de origem não compatíveis: chaves primárias compostas](#CHAP_Tasks.AssessmentReport.Assessments.All.CompositeNoPrimaryKey)

## Tipos de dados incompatíveis
<a name="CHAP_Tasks.AssessmentReport.Assessments.All.UnsupportedDataTypes"></a>

**Chave da API:** `unsupported-data-types-in-source`

Verifica os tipos de dados no endpoint de origem com os quais o DMS não é compatível. Nem todos os tipos de dados podem ser migrados entre os mecanismos.

## Objetos grandes (LOBs) são usados, mas as colunas LOB de destino não são anuláveis
<a name="CHAP_Tasks.AssessmentReport.Assessments.All.LOBsColsNotNullable"></a>

**Chave da API:** `full-lob-not-nullable-at-target`

Verifica a nulidade de uma coluna LOB no destino quando a replicação utiliza o modo LOB completo ou o modo LOB em linha. O DMS exige que uma coluna LOB seja nula ao usar esses modos de LOB. Essa avaliação exige que os bancos de dados de origem e de destino sejam relacionais.

## Tabela de origem com objetos grandes (LOBs), mas sem chaves primárias ou restrições exclusivas
<a name="CHAP_Tasks.AssessmentReport.Assessments.All.LOBsNoPrimaryKey"></a>

**Chave da API:** `table-with-lob-but-without-primary-key-or-unique-constraint`

 Verifica a presença de tabelas de origem com LOBs , mas sem, uma chave primária ou uma chave exclusiva. Uma tabela deve ter uma chave primária ou uma chave exclusiva para que o DMS migre LOBs. Essa avaliação exige que o banco de dados de origem seja relacional.

## Tabela de origem sem chave primária somente para tarefas de CDC ou de carga máxima e CDC
<a name="CHAP_Tasks.AssessmentReport.Assessments.All.CDCNoPrimaryKey"></a>

**Chave da API:** `table-with-no-primary-key-or-unique-constraint`

 Verifica a presença de uma chave primária ou de uma chave exclusiva nas tabelas de origem para uma migração de carga máxima e de captura de dados de alteração (CDC), ou uma migração somente de CDC. A falta de uma chave primária ou de uma chave exclusiva pode causar problemas de desempenho durante a migração de CDC. Essa avaliação exige que o banco de dados de origem seja relacional e que o tipo de migração inclua CDC.

## Tabela de destino sem chaves primárias somente para tarefas de CDC
<a name="CHAP_Tasks.AssessmentReport.Assessments.All.CDCOnlyNoPrimaryKey"></a>

**Chave da API:** `target-table-has-unique-key-or-primary-key-for-cdc`

 Verifica a presença de uma chave primária ou de uma chave exclusiva em tabelas de destino já criadas para uma migração somente de CDC. A falta de uma chave primária ou de uma chave exclusiva pode causar verificações completas de tabelas no destino quando o DMS aplica atualizações e exclusões. Isso pode resultar em problemas de desempenho durante a migração de CDC. Essa avaliação exige que o banco de dados de destino seja relacional e que o tipo de migração inclua CDC.

## Tipos de chave primária de origem não compatíveis: chaves primárias compostas
<a name="CHAP_Tasks.AssessmentReport.Assessments.All.CompositeNoPrimaryKey"></a>

**Chave da API:** `unsupported-source-pk-type-for-elasticsearch-target`

Verifica a presença de chaves primárias compostas nas tabelas de origem ao migrar para o Amazon OpenSearch Service. A chave primária da tabela de origem deve ser composta de uma só coluna. Essa avaliação exige que o banco de dados de origem seja relacional e que o banco de dados de destino seja DynamoDB.

**nota**  
O DMS oferece suporte à migração de um banco de dados de origem para um destino OpenSearch de serviço em que a chave primária de origem consiste em várias colunas. 